Request for Information Regarding Manufacturing USA Institutes and Processes
Document Number: 2020-03896
Type: Notice
Date: 2020-02-27
Agency: Department of Commerce, National Institute of Standards and Technology
The Manufacturing USA reauthorization prescribes three pathways for creating centers for manufacturing innovation or institutes in the Manufacturing USA network. Through this Request for Information (RFI), NIST is seeking comment from the public on the pathway where manufacturing centers outside of Manufacturing USA are recognized by the Secretary of Commerce as centers for manufacturing innovation in response to a formal request by the centers for such recognition. The law provides that a manufacturing center substantially similar to Manufacturing USA institutes, but which do not have federal sponsorship, may be recognized for participation in the network, but does not specify criteria for similarity. This pathway may be termed the ``alliance'' model for membership in Manufacturing USA. These could be existing agency-sponsored institutes which are no longer under a federal financial aid agreement or existing entities not in the network with relevant characteristics that are new to the network. Through this RFI, NIST also is seeking broad input and participation from stakeholders to assist in identifying and prioritizing issues and proposed solutions on the information provided regarding the proposed ``alliance'' path to designate a Manufacturing USA Institute, including what should be the minimum characteristics and requirements for such entities.
